Description

Applied principles as well as recording components of holograms are elaborated in this up-to-date book. It presents an overview on current developments in the advancement of a broad range of holographic recording substances comprising of ionic liquids in photopolymerisable materials, azo-dye containing materials, porous glass and polymer composites, amorphous chalcogenide films, Norland optical adhesive as holographic recording material and organic photochromic materials. Comprehensive evaluation of collinear holographic information storage and polychromatic rebuilding for volume holographic memory has also been discussed. New holographic devices, as well as utilization of holograms in security and signal processing have also been presented in this book.
